A rare opportunity to acquire a characterful Edwardian garden flat nestled in a desirable tree-lined cul-de-sac in Teddington. Just moments from the train station and vibrant local shops, the apartment is sold with a Share of Freehold, ensuring peace of mind.
The beautifully presented apartment graces the entire ground floor of a handsome Edwardian semi-detached house, boasting a wealth of period features such as high ceilings, elegant deep picture rails and a charming cast iron fireplace.
Step inside to discover superbly proportioned rooms, where the heart of the home lies in the magnificent 13 ft. Reception room. Here, you'll find a delightful period fireplace adorned with a granite hearth and expansive triple sash windows, enhanced by traditional wooden shutters that invite natural light throughout the day.
The thoughtfully designed rear kitchen offers warmth and brightness, with plenty of space for dining along with a convenient utility area and a sleek modern shower room. The generously sized double bedroom features tranquil views of the pretty garden and provides ample storage for all your needs.
Outside, your own private garden awaits, featuring a lovely open view that stretches across the treetops. Enjoy mornings in the sun or evening relaxation on the paved seating area, surrounded by attractive mature planting.
Sunnyside Road is a highly desirable cul-de-sac known for its quietness and community spirit. It offers easy access to excellent schools and transport links, as well as the amenities of Broad Street and Teddington High Street. You are also mere moments away from the natural beauty of Bushy Park, the River Thames, and the bustling Kingston town centre.
Sold with the Share of Freehold.
